Structure and Working Principle

HMC Pulse Jet Industrial Dust Collector for Cement Plants
 
This Heavy-Duty Dust Collector consists of a housing, fan, dust hopper (optional), and pulse jet cleaning mechanism. It comes in six configurations, categorized as Type A (with hopper) and Type B (without hopper). Dust-laden air enters the collector, where filter bags supported by durable metal frames capture particulate matter. The purified air is discharged through the fan, while collected dust settles into the hopper.

The cleaning process is controlled by an automated system, which monitors dust accumulation. When resistance reaches a set threshold, compressed air is released into the filter bags, causing them to expand and dislodge accumulated dust. This dust is collected in the hopper for disposal. The system ensures continuous operation with minimal downtime, making it ideal for industries such as cement, mining, and materials processing.

FAQ
Q : What parameters are required for designing a dust collector?
A: To accurately design a dust collector, we need the following parameters: air volume, pressure, local emission standards, and whether the system will handle dust or flue gas. If dealing with flue gas, the temperature must also be provided.
Q : Can we design a dust collector if the customer only provides a factory layout without specific parameters?
A: Yes, we can design a dust collector based on the customer's factory layout and provide a proposal and quotation to ensure compatibility with the existing space and optimal system arrangement.
Q : What materials are used for filter bags?
A: We provide filter bags in various materials, including polyester needle-punched felt, PPS (polyphenylene sulfide), and PTFE (polytetrafluoroethylene), to accommodate different operating conditions and dust characteristics.
Q : What is the minimum emission standard that can be achieved?
A: Our dust collectors can meet extremely low emission standards, with the lowest achievable emission level being below 1mg/m³, complying with strict environmental regulations.
Q : What are the available dust discharge methods?
A: The dust discharge methods include bulk bag collection, dust bucket collection, and screw conveyors. The most suitable method can be selected based on the customer's processing requirements and site conditions.
Q : What is the typical service life of a dust collector?
A: Under normal usage and proper maintenance, a dust collector typically has a service life of over 10 years.
